What is the Most Durable Furniture Material?

A piece can look solid in the showroom and fall apart in 18 months. I’ve seen it happen with oak-finish particleboard dining tables, bonded leather sofas, and powder-coated steel outdoor chairs that weren’t actually powder-coated, just painted.

The most durable furniture material depends entirely on what the piece is, where it lives, and how hard it gets used. There is no single answer that works for every room.

What there is: a clear hierarchy of materials that hold up versus ones that don’t, and a set of construction details that separate long-lasting furniture from furniture that just looks like it should last.

Most Durable Furniture Materials: Quick Comparison

Different materials serve different functions. A dining table, a sofa frame, an outdoor bench, and a dresser all face different types of stress, weight, friction, moisture, UV exposure, and mechanical impact. This table covers the materials that consistently perform across those categories.

Material Janka / Hardness Best Use Cost Range Durability
Hickory (hardwood) 1,820 lbf Frames, tables, chairs $6–$10/board ft Very High
Hard maple (hardwood) 1,450 lbf Dining tables, dressers $5–$9/board ft Very High
White oak (hardwood) 1,360 lbf Tables, bed frames, cabinets $6–$12/board ft Very High
Teak (hardwood) 1,155 lbf Outdoor furniture $20–$35/board ft Very High (outdoor)
Steel (powder-coated) N/A — tensile Frames, patio, shelving Mid–high (finished piece) Very High
Aluminum N/A — tensile Outdoor chairs, frames Mid High (rust-resistant)
Granite / Quartz N/A — Mohs 6–7 Tabletops High Very High
Performance fabric (Crypton) N/A — rub count Sofas, dining chairs Mid–high High
Full-grain leather N/A — rub count Sofas, chairs High Very High (maintained)
HDPE N/A — plastic Outdoor benches, chairs Mid High
High-pressure laminate N/A — surface Desks, kids’ furniture Low–mid Medium
Low-grade particleboard Very low Budget decorative only Low Low

Hardwood Janka ratings from the Wood Database. Janka hardness measures the force required to embed a steel ball halfway into the wood, higher numbers mean harder wood and better resistance to denting and wear.

Most Durable Materials for Frames, Tables, and Storage

1. Solid Hardwood

solid wood dining table, chairs, bookshelf, and dresser in a warm sunlit room with natural wood grain

Solid hardwood is the benchmark for frame durability. What makes it different from engineered alternatives isn’t appearance, it’s how the material responds to stress over time. Kiln-dried hardwood resists warping and cracking because the moisture has been removed before the wood was milled.

A dining table frame made from kiln-dried white oak (1,360 lbf Janka) will absorb daily use, minor impacts, and seasonal humidity changes without losing structural integrity. The same table built from undried or low-grade softwood will start showing movement within a few years.

Species matter. Oak, maple, hickory, walnut, and ash all outperform pine, poplar, or rubber wood in a structural role. Teak sits in its own category for outdoor applications because of its natural oil content, which makes it resistant to moisture and insects without annual treatment.

Durability: Very high when kiln-dried and properly finished.
Best for: Dining tables, bed frames, bookshelves, dressers, sofa frames, cabinets.
Worst for: Perpetually damp spaces, solid wood moves with moisture, and a basement or bathroom will eventually work against it regardless of finish quality.

2. Metal (Steel and Aluminum)

bright modern room with a black metal bed frame, metal dining chairs, silver shelving, and outdoor metal patio furniture

Steel is one of the strongest structural materials available for furniture, and it’s used in commercial seating and shelving specifically because it doesn’t flex under sustained load the way wood eventually can.

The catch is finish quality. Bare steel rusts. Powder coating, where electrostatically charged pigment particles are baked onto the surface, creates a protective layer that resists chipping and corrosion. Ask specifically whether outdoor metal furniture uses powder-coated steel or just painted steel. Painted steel looks identical and fails within two to three seasons in a wet climate.

Aluminum is the right choice where rust resistance is the priority. It weighs about a third as much as steel, doesn’t corrode, and holds up well in coastal and high-humidity environments without any protective coating. The trade-off is that aluminum dents more easily than steel under impact.

Durability: Very high for structural use; powder-coated steel and aluminum outperform bare metal significantly outdoors.
Best for: Bed frames, desk frames, shelving, patio chairs, dining chair bases.
Worst for: Coastal outdoor settings if untreated, saltwater accelerates corrosion even on coated steel.

3. Stone (Granite and Quartz)

granite or quartz stone dining table with a matching console table in a bright modern room, showing durable hard surfaces

For tabletops, granite and quartz are about as close to indestructible as a surface material gets. Granite rates 6–7 on the Mohs hardness scale, harder than most metals. Quartz tabletops are engineered from about 90% crushed quartz bound with resin, which makes them slightly more consistent and less porous than natural stone.

Marble belongs in a separate category: it scores 3–4 on the Mohs scale, which means it scratches easily and etches permanently when exposed to acids, wine, citrus, vinegar, even sealed.

The practical limitation of stone is weight and brittleness at the edges. A dropped pot or a sharp corner impact can chip granite, and replacing a stone tabletop section isn’t possible the way refinishing wood is.

Durability: Very high for scratch and heat resistance; edge vulnerability is the weak point.
Best for: Dining tables, coffee tables, console tables where the surface takes regular use.
Worst for: Homes where the furniture gets moved frequently, stone tabletops are heavy and the edges don’t tolerate rough handling.

Most Durable Upholstery Materials for Sofas and Seating

Frame durability and upholstery durability are separate questions. A sofa can have an excellent kiln-dried hardwood frame and fail in three years because the fabric couldn’t handle daily use. Upholstery wear is measured differently, look for rub count ratings, which measure how many double rubs (back-and-forth passes) the fabric survives before breaking down.

For a family sofa in daily use, anything below 15,000 double rubs is a risk. 30,000 and above is where the fabric starts to become genuinely long-lasting.

4. Performance Fabric (Including Crypton)

bright living room with performance fabric sofa, armchairs, coffee spill, kids' books, and dog on the rug

Performance fabric is the category term for synthetic or treated upholstery fabrics engineered to resist stains, fading, and friction. The key difference from standard fabric is that the fiber itself, not a surface treatment, provides the resistance.

Crypton is the best-known brand in this category. It builds moisture and stain barriers directly into the fiber structure, which means the protection doesn’t wash out over time the way topical spray-on treatments do. Rub counts for high-quality performance fabric commonly land above 50,000 double rubs.

For homes with kids or pets, performance fabric is usually the most practical choice for most durable furniture material when upholstery is the primary concern. It handles spills, odors, and pet hair better than almost anything else at a comparable price point.

5. Microfiber

microfiber sofa and armchair in a cozy living room with a dog, showing pet-friendly and everyday upholstery use

Microfiber is a tightly woven synthetic fabric, typically polyester or nylon, where the fibers are split to diameters smaller than a human hair. That density is what gives it durability.

It resists snagging, repels pet hair reasonably well, and holds up to daily friction better than loosely woven naturals like cotton or linen blends. It’s the most budget-friendly durable upholstery option available. The practical downside is static and dust attraction, which means regular vacuuming is necessary to keep it clean.

Durability: High for everyday use; performance drops if the fabric isn’t cleaned regularly.
Best for: Family sofas, recliners, apartment seating, homes with pets.
Worst for: Anyone sensitive to static or dust, microfiber is a magnet for both.

6. Full-Grain and Top-Grain Leather

brown genuine leather sofa and recliner in a warm living room, showing durable upholstery and classic comfort

Full-grain leather is the outer layer of the hide with the grain intact, the most structurally dense part of the skin. It develops a patina over years of use rather than degrading, which is why heirloom-quality sofas and chairs are almost always full-grain.

Top-grain leather has been lightly sanded to remove imperfections, which makes it more uniform in appearance but slightly less durable than full-grain over decades of use. Both are significantly more durable than bonded leather, which is a composite of leather scraps and synthetic binders, and one of the fastest-failing upholstery materials available.

Leather requires conditioning every 6–12 months in dry climates. Without it, the surface dries and eventually cracks. Keep it out of direct sunlight and away from heating vents.

Durability: Very high for full-grain and top-grain, maintained correctly. Bonded leather typically fails in 3–5 years.
Best for: Sofas, recliners, office chairs, formal seating, any piece you expect to own for 15+ years.
Worst for: Homes with cats, or rooms with heavy direct sun exposure.

7. Vinyl and PU Fabric

vinyl and pu seating in a clean waiting room, with a spill being wiped from a smooth easy-clean chair

Vinyl and polyurethane fabrics are the most moisture-resistant upholstery options available. Wipe them with a damp cloth and they’re clean. That’s the primary reason they appear in healthcare, hospitality, and rental furniture.

Vinyl is tougher but stiff and non-breathable in warm temperatures. PU fabric is softer and more flexible, with an appearance closer to leather. Neither will develop the way genuine leather does over time, and both can crack in cold temperatures if they’re not kept supple.

Durability: High for moisture resistance and frequent cleaning; long-term durability in residential use is moderate.
Best for: Dining chairs, rental properties, commercial seating, kids’ furniture.
Worst for: Hot climates or sun-exposed rooms, both materials can become sticky and degrade with sustained heat exposure.

Most Durable Materials for Outdoor Furniture

Outdoor materials face a different set of failure modes than indoor ones: UV degradation, moisture cycling, freeze-thaw stress, and in coastal areas, salt corrosion. A material that lasts 20 years indoors might fail in three seasons outdoors if it wasn’t designed for weather exposure.

8. Teak, Aluminum, and HDPE

outdoor patio with teak dining table, aluminum chairs, hdpe poolside seats, and garden furniture in sunlight

Teak’s durability outdoors comes from its natural silica and oil content, which make it resistant to moisture absorption and insect damage without requiring annual sealing. It weathers to a silver-grey if left untreated, which some people prefer, and can be restored with teak oil if you want to maintain the original color. Its Janka rating of 1,155 lbf also means it resists surface denting from outdoor use.

For the best outdoor furniture made without wood, aluminum and HDPE are the two materials I’d use. Aluminum doesn’t rust, is light enough to move easily, and holds a powder-coat finish well. HDPE (high-density polyethylene) is made from recycled plastic, it’s dense, heavy, UV-stable, and doesn’t crack or splinter even after years of freeze-thaw cycles.

It looks like painted wood from a distance. It requires almost no maintenance. The only knock against HDPE is that it can warp under sustained direct heat, avoid placing it directly against dark surfaces in hot climates.

Durability: Very high for all three materials in outdoor conditions.
Best for: Patio dining sets, benches, poolside seating, balcony furniture.
Worst for: Anyone who wants lightweight portability, teak and HDPE are both heavy.

Materials That Look Durable but Wear Out Faster

Some materials fail in specific, predictable ways. Knowing the failure mode ahead of time is more useful than a general “avoid this” warning.

1. Bonded Leather

worn bonded leather sofa with peeling and cracked upholstery, showing why it wears faster than genuine leather

Bonded leather is roughly 20% leather fiber mixed with polyurethane binders. The surface film peels away from the backing in sheets, usually starting at the seat edges and armrests, and there’s no repair path. Once it starts peeling, the piece is finished. The typical lifespan for a bonded leather sofa in daily use is three to five years.

2. Low-Grade Particleboard

low grade particleboard bookshelf with sagging shelves crumbling edges and books showing weak support

Particleboard is compressed wood chips held together with resin. The problem isn’t the material itself, high-density particleboard has legitimate uses, it’s that low-grade particleboard swells when exposed to moisture, strips out around screw holes under repeated loading, and sags under sustained weight.

A bookshelf built from it will lose its shape within a few years. Avoid it for any piece that carries meaningful load: bed frames, bookshelves, dining tables, cabinets.

3. Cheap Plastic and Untreated Metal (Outdoors)

faded blue plastic patio chairs and table with cracks and brittle edges from sun and outdoor weather exposure

Polypropylene patio furniture, the inexpensive stackable kind, becomes brittle in UV exposure within two to three summers, depending on climate. The plastic doesn’t crack suddenly; it loses flexibility gradually until it snaps under normal use.

Untreated metal follows a similar arc through rust: surface oxidation, then structural corrosion at joints and welds, then failure. For outdoor use, neither material is worth buying if you’re expecting more than a couple of seasons from it.

4. Loose-Weave Fabrics, Silk, and Untreated Linen

loose weave sofa with snagged threads pilling trapped pet hair and a cat pulling at the fabric

Loose-weave fabrics snag under pet claws, pill from daily friction, and trap hair in the gaps between threads. Silk looks exceptional and fails quickly, it can’t handle sunlight, moisture, or consistent contact pressure, making it unsuitable for any furniture that actually gets sat on.

Untreated linen stains easily and wrinkles permanently. These materials work in low-traffic, decorative contexts. For a sofa a family uses every day, they’re wrong choices from the start.

What to Check Before Buying Any Piece of Furniture

Material choice is only part of the durability equation. Construction quality is the other half, and it’s easier to spot than most people think. The following checks apply regardless of which material you’re evaluating.

  • Frame joinery: Look for screws combined with corner blocks, or traditional joinery like mortise-and-tenon and dovetail. Staples and glue alone indicate a frame built to a price, not a lifespan.
  • Frame material: Ask specifically, kiln-dried hardwood, steel, or furniture-grade plywood are the acceptable answers. “Solid wood” can legally refer to softwoods or engineered composites depending on the retailer.
  • Upholstery rub count: Request this for any sofa or chair. 15,000 double rubs is minimum for light use; 30,000+ for daily family use; 50,000+ for high-traffic or commercial applications.
  • Fabric weave tightness: Run your hand across the surface. If you can see individual threads clearly, it will snag. Tight weaves resist pet claws and daily friction far better.
  • Cushion density: High-resilience (HR) foam, typically rated at 1.8 lb/cubic ft density or above — holds its shape significantly longer than standard foam. Avoid “dacron wrapped” claims without checking what’s underneath.
  • Finish quality on wood: Multiple thin coats of finish protect better than one thick application. Run your hand along underside edges — raw, unfinished undersides suggest the piece was built to look good from the front only.
  • Outdoor finish type: For metal outdoor furniture, confirm powder coating rather than spray paint. For wood, confirm the species and whether it’s naturally weather-resistant or requires regular sealing.

How to Make Durable Furniture Last Longer

Even the most durable furniture material degrades faster when it’s used against its grain, literally or figuratively. Keep heavy indoor pieces on level flooring so joints don’t torque under uneven load.

Avoid dragging furniture across hard floors; the stress concentrates at the leg joints, which are usually the first thing to fail. Rotate sofa cushions every few months so compression distributes evenly rather than compressing in one spot permanently.

For wood furniture, keep pieces away from heating vents and direct sunlight. Both dry out the wood and the finish faster than normal use does.

For leather, conditioning once or twice a year is the single most effective maintenance habit, a quality hide cream applied every six months prevents the cracking that makes leather sofas look old before their time. For outdoor furniture, covering it during off-season or during extended storms extends its useful life meaningfully, even with teak or HDPE.

Furniture Material Maintenance by Type

  • Vacuum upholstered pieces weekly to prevent debris from embedding in the weave and acting as abrasive material against the fiber.
  • Blot liquid spills immediately, don’t rub. Rubbing forces liquid deeper into upholstery fibers.
  • Use coasters and trivets on wood, stone, and laminate surfaces. Heat rings in wood finishes and etching on stone from acidic liquids are both permanent.
  • Condition leather every 6–12 months, more frequently in dry climates or air-conditioned spaces.
  • Wipe metal furniture dry after rain or heavy humidity, even powder-coated steel benefits from drying to avoid water spots and early surface oxidation.
  • Clean outdoor furniture at the start and end of each season to remove pollen, mildew, and salt buildup before it works into joints and surfaces.
  • Check the cleaning code on upholstered pieces before applying any product: W (water-based), S (solvent-based), WS (both), or X (vacuum only).

Is the Price Premium for Durable Materials Worth It?

Almost always, yes, when the alternative is replacing the piece. A bonded leather sofa at $600 that fails in four years costs more over a decade than a $1,800 full-grain leather piece that lasts 20 years with basic care. The same math applies to particleboard dining tables versus solid oak, and to cheap plastic outdoor chairs versus HDPE.

That said, price alone doesn’t guarantee durability. A high price can reflect design, brand, or fabric choice rather than construction quality. A $3,000 sofa with a softwood frame and low-rub fabric isn’t better than a $1,200 sofa with kiln-dried hardwood and 35,000-rub performance fabric.

Check the actual specifications, not the marketing. Contract-grade furniture, pieces built to commercial standards, is tested to specific durability thresholds that most retail furniture doesn’t have to meet, and it’s worth seeking out for high-use pieces.

What is the strongest material for a sofa frame?

Kiln-dried hardwood, specifically oak, maple, or hickory, is the strongest frame material for sofas. Kiln-drying removes moisture before milling, which prevents warping and cracking over time. Steel frames are comparably strong but less common in residential sofas.

What is the most durable fabric for a couch?

Performance fabric with a rub count of 30,000 or above, including Crypton, is the most durable upholstery choice for a couch in daily use. Full-grain leather is equally durable and easier to wipe clean, but requires conditioning to prevent cracking.

Which furniture material is best for homes with pets?

Microfiber, Crypton, and full-grain leather all handle pet use well. Microfiber and Crypton resist pet hair and stains; leather wipes clean easily. Avoid any loose-weave fabric — cat and dog claws pull threads and the damage compounds quickly.

What wood is most durable for furniture?

Hickory (1,820 lbf Janka), hard maple (1,450 lbf), and white oak (1,360 lbf) are the three hardest domestic hardwoods commonly used in furniture. For outdoor furniture, teak is in a separate category due to its natural oil content and weather resistance.

What is the most durable material for outdoor furniture?

Teak, aluminum, and HDPE are the three outdoor materials that consistently hold up across multiple seasons. Teak resists moisture and insects naturally; aluminum doesn’t rust; HDPE resists UV degradation and freeze-thaw cracking better than any other plastic.

Is laminate furniture worth buying?

High-pressure laminate is legitimate for desks, kids’ tables, and low-cost dining furniture where the surface takes direct wear. Its weakness is edges and seams — once moisture gets in through damaged edging, the substrate swells and the piece is done. It’s not refinishable.

Why does bonded leather peel?

Bonded leather is a laminate of leather scraps and polyurethane binder. The top film delaminates from the base layer under the mechanical stress of daily sitting, particularly at seat edges and armrests. There’s no repair for delamination; the piece fails completely within a few years.
